Anna Tunikova
Born in Saint Petersburg in 1994, the graphic designer and painter Anna Tunikova went to school in Schleswig-Holstein and has a degree in communication design. The artist comes from a family creative background. She first experimented in airbrushing with bright colours and painted figurative pictures. Anna soon realised, however, that these pictures did not express what she herself felt at the time: contrary to the flood of impressions we are exposed to every day anyway, she longed for calm and simplicity.
The Russian-born artist is following the war in Ukraine with dismay and great concern and, like many other Russian cultural workers, is committed to showing solidarity and helping the people in Ukraine. Tunikova is currently working on an oil painting in the darkened Ukrainian colours of yellow and blue, 100% of the proceeds of which will go to Ukrainian refugees. (Price: € 4,400)
Anna Tunikova lives and works in Berlin.
